BlackRock Enhanced Large Cap Core Fund Inc (CII) operates as a closed-end investment fund managed by BlackRock, Inc. The fund employs an enhanced index strategy, seeking to achieve investment results that exceed the performance of the S&P 500 Index while maintaining similar risk characteristics. As a closed-end fund, CII trades on an exchange and maintains a fixed number of shares, distinguishing it from open-end mutual funds.
